山門也有門門道道,
開發、測試、安卓......
小子被納入MIS小山峰,雖不及BOP勢力龐大,高手如雲,
僅寥寥七人,
卻也於入小山峰之事樂趣至極。
前幾日峰主布下一道新手任務,
制作一張單表並運行
------------------------------------------------------------------------------------------------------------------------------------------------------------------------
1、環境
2、項目運行
3、單表制作
------------------------------------------------------------------------------------------------------------------------------------------------------------------------
1、環境
JDK1.8(原用JKD9,奈何JDK9目錄結構大變樣,環境變量配置也有所不同,項目運行報出各種奇怪的ERROR,需謹記與項目組使用同樣的環境)
IDEA2017.1(配置完畢后需按各個山門的門規進行代碼編寫規范和插件下載配置,本門規於文檔庫)
Maven(需本地重新下載,修改默認配置於C盤的本地倉庫,修改配置文件,然后於IDEA中settings修改maven為自主安裝的maven)
Git版本控制(小烏龜搭配使用,git需生成SSH文件,將其一有后綴的文件內容復制於gitlab相應處,之后git config user.name/email+”本人道號”,也可於小烏龜中配置)
數據庫使用的遠程連接的工具,因數據結構均處於統一服務器,只需遠程連接即可(正好方便我的雲服務器O(∩_∩)O哈哈~)
2、項目運行
(1)項目克隆(自行編寫腳本運行)
(2)克隆完畢后需謹記創建本地分支,切換分支
(3)IDEA打開項目
(4)各個模塊pom文件adding to maven
(5)在IDEA右側的maven project中reimport maven projects
(6)修改配置文件(config_server)
(7)模塊依次運行或者debug
3、單表制作
(1)首先在數據庫工具制作表
查看試圖效果:
數據庫表設計(注意加注釋):
(2)使用逆向工程自動生成代碼
(3)代碼編譯
使用到Mybatis、springmvc、springboot、springcloud、spring
freemaker、bootstrap、angularjs、jquery
完成后代碼文件: